• Linus Torvalds's avatar
    Merge branch 'for-linus' of git://git.armlinux.org.uk/~rmk/linux-arm · 07171da2
    Linus Torvalds authored
    Pull ARM updates from Russell King:
     "The main item in this pull request are the Spectre variant 1.1 fixes
      from Julien Thierry.
    
      A few other patches to improve various areas, and removal of some
      obsolete mcount bits and a redundant kbuild conditional"
    
    * 'for-linus' of git://git.armlinux.org.uk/~rmk/linux-arm:
      ARM: 8802/1: Call syscall_trace_exit even when system call skipped
      ARM: 8797/1: spectre-v1.1: harden __copy_to_user
      ARM: 8796/1: spectre-v1,v1.1: provide helpers for address sanitization
      ARM: 8795/1: spectre-v1.1: use put_user() for __put_user()
      ARM: 8794/1: uaccess: Prevent speculative use of the current addr_limit
      ARM: 8793/1: signal: replace __put_user_error with __put_user
      ARM: 8792/1: oabi-compat: copy oabi events using __copy_to_user()
      ARM: 8791/1: vfp: use __copy_to_user() when saving VFP state
      ARM: 8790/1: signal: always use __copy_to_user to save iwmmxt context
      ARM: 8789/1: signal: copy registers using __copy_to_user()
      ARM: 8801/1: makefile: use ARMv3M mode for RiscPC
      ARM: 8800/1: use choice for kernel unwinders
      ARM: 8798/1: remove unnecessary KBUILD_SRC ifeq conditional
      ARM: 8788/1: ftrace: remove old mcount support
      ARM: 8786/1: Debug kernel copy by printing
    07171da2
Kconfig.debug 68.1 KB